Output e5189db98164048a8688b6fc033f300b32739291ac06f4ae1c0cee98b29a09bf:42

value
790784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4453f7385f3b55f5d726677f7d66137af6da1f5 OP_EQUAL
address
3KaoKZtnePbnZvJdzXVmSLy5ABLLeemMa9
transaction
e5189db98164048a8688b6fc033f300b32739291ac06f4ae1c0cee98b29a09bf
spent
true